My most recent acquisition: the God Pusher. I bought directly from a coworker, who it was made for he believes in 2005. As far as I can tell it's unique in two ways: one, it has the name of who it's made for on the OUTSIDE of the pedal. And two, it has no writing of any kind on the inside of the pedal (I don't know if this was common practice in the earlier D*A*M days but I've yet to see a pic of a pedal that doesn't have some kind of writing on the inside. It's a fantastic beast, and has the most insane amount of low end I've ever heard and when the tube drive is maxed it's amost a fuzz type of tone. I don't know if this should be in the "one offs" section considering I know there were a few other God Pushers made. Any more info anyone has on this pedal would be cool to know about. Post by The Captain »

:bigteeth:

Shweet! Super nice indeed to see this swine once again. Very enjoyable built as I recall. It kinda is a one off as its the only one I made like that. There were only three God Pushers and only two had that type of chassis. This one was how I planned on making them....then I found out the Tube Driver had been reissued :hihi: I still use the prototype of the GP as a pre-amp.
